/* body properties*/
body
{
	margin: 0 0 0 0 ;
	background-color: #ffffff;
}
.bgwhite
{
	background-color: #ffffff;
}
.bggreen
{
	background-color:#DCF1C6;
}
.contentheading
{
	font: bold 13px arial;
	color: #6F95AF;
}
.contenttitle
{
	font: bold 11px arial;
	color: #676767;
}
.gridtitle
{
	font: bold 13px arial;
	color: #676767;
}
.calcontent
{
	font: normal 10px arial;
	color: #666666;
}
.content
{
	font: normal 14px arial;
	color: #000000;
}
.contentbig
{
	font: normal 12px arial;
	color: #676767;
}
.tableborder
{
	border: solid 1px #999999;
}
.borderbottom
{
	border-bottom: solid 1px #999999;
}
.bottomline
{
	 background-color: #999999;
}

.txtbox
{
	border:solid 1px #000000;
	font: normal 11px arial ;
	color:#676767;
	width:150;
	height:20;
	vertical-align:middle;		
}
.txtboxbig
{
	border:solid 1px #000000;
	font: normal 11px arial ;
	color:#676767;
	width:210;
	height:19;
	vertical-align:middle;	
	
}
.txtboxsmall
{
	border:solid 1px #000000;
	font: normal 11px arial ;
	color:#676767;
	width:120px;
	height:19;
	vertical-align:middle;	
	
}
.txtarea
{
	border:solid 1px #000000;
	font: normal 11px arial ;
	color:#676767;
	width:210;
	vertical-align:middle;	
	
}
.txtwidth
{
	width:70%;
}
.flecontrol
{
	border:solid 1px #000000;
	font: normal 11px arial ;
	color:#676767;
	width:280;
	vertical-align:middle;	
	
}
.dropdownlist
{
	border:solid 1px #000000;
	font: normal 12px arial ;
	color:#676767;	
	height:20;
	vertical-align:middle;		
}
.button
{
	background-color:#F4F4F4;
	font:bold 11px arial,verdana,Times New Roman;
	color:#000000; 
	border:solid 1px #000000;
	cursor:hand;
}
.leftlinkSelected
{
	font: bold 11px arial ;
	color: #666666;
	text-decoration: none;
}
.leftlinkSelected
{
	font: bold 11px arial ;
	color: #666666;
	text-decoration: none;
}

.leftlinkSelected a:link
{
	font: bold 11px arial ;
	color: #666666;
	text-decoration: none;
}
.leftlinkSelected a:visited
{
	font: bold 11px arial ;
	color: #666666;
	text-decoration: none;
}
.leftlink
{
	font: normal 14px arial ;
	color: #214995;
	text-decoration: none;
}

.leftlink a:link
{
	font: normal 14px arial ;
	color: #214995;
	text-decoration: none;
}
.leftlink a:visited
{
	font: normal 14px arial ;
	color: #214995;
	text-decoration: none;
}
.leftlink a:hover
{
	font: normal 14px arial ;
	color: #214995;
	text-decoration: underline;
}
.pagenavigate
{
	font: bold 11px arial ;
	color: #676767;
	text-decoration: none;
}
.pagenavigate a:link
{
	font: bold 11px arial ;
	color: #676767;
	text-decoration: underline;
}
.pagenavigate a:visited
{
	font: bold 11px arial ;
	color: #676767;
	text-decoration: underline;
}
.pagenavigate a:hover
{
	font: bold 11px arial ;
	color: #676767;
	text-decoration: none;
}
.onover
{
	cursor: hand;
}
.sepbottom
{
	background: url(../images/SepBottom.gif);	
	background-repeat: repeat-x;
	background-position: bottom right;
	
}
.sepleft
{
	background:url(../images/SepLeft.gif);
	background-repeat:repeat-y;	
	background-position: top left;
}
.sepright
{
	background:url(../images/SepLeft.gif);
	background-repeat:repeat-y;	
	background-position: top right;
}
.lpad
{
	padding-left:10px;
}
.errormsg
{
	font: normal 13px arial ;
	color: #ff0000;
	text-decoration: none;
}
/* Footer user control */
.bar
{
	 background-color: #EAEAEA;
}
.footer
{
	font: normal 11px arial ;
	color: #676767;
	text-decoration: none;
}
.footerunderline
{
	font: normal 11px arial ;
	color: #676767;
	text-decoration: underline;
}
.footer a:link
{
	font: normal 11px arial ;
	color: #676767;
	text-decoration: underline;
}
.footer a:hover
{
	font: normal 11px arial ;
	color: #676767;
	text-decoration: none;
}
/* Header User Control */
.leftcontentheader
{
	font:bold 12px arial;
	color:#274B95;
	padding:2 10 0 10;
}
.leftcontentheader1
{
	font:normal 12px arial;
	color:#000000;
	padding:2 5 0 10;
}
.leftcontentheader1bold
{
	font:bold 13px arial;
	color:#000000;	
}
.leftheaderbgcolor
{
	background-color:#FF9600;
}
.headerbgcolor
{
	background-color:#DCF1C6;
}
/*header link properties*/
.bgcolor1
{
	background-color: #BFBFBF;
}
.bgcolor2
{
	background-color: #FF9600;
}
.bgcolor3
{
	background-color: #EEF8E3;
}
.bgcolor4
{
	/*background-color: #FEFBF6;*/
	background-color: #FFF7F3;
}
.linkbackground
{	
	font: bold 12px arial ;
	color: #6F6F6F;
	text-decoration: none;	
	padding-top: 4px;	
	background: url(../images/header_linkbody.gif);
	background-repeat: repeat-x;
	
}
.linkbackground1
{
	background-image:  url(../images/header_linkbody.gif);	
	border-top: solid 2px #FF9600;
	font: bold 12px arial ;
	color: #6F6F6F;
	text-decoration: none;	
	padding-top: 4px;
	background-repeat: repeat-x;
}
.linkcontent
{
	font: bold 12px arial ;
	color: #6F6F6F;
	text-decoration: none;	
	padding-top: 4px;
	width: 100%;
	height: 100%;
}
.headerbar
{
	background-color: #F3F3F3;
}
/* Post Summary  */
.sepline
{
	/*background-color: #F3F3F3;*/
	background-color:#FFEFDD;
}
/*.postsummary
{
	font: normal 12px arial ;
	color: #676767;
	text-decoration: none;
}*/
.postsummary
{
	font: normal 14px arial ;
	color: #000000;
	text-decoration: none;
	line-height:1.5;
}
/*.postsummarybold
{
	font: bold 11px arial ;
	color: #676767;
	text-decoration: none;
}*/
.postsummarybold
{
	font: bold 13px arial ;
	color: #FF9400;
	text-decoration: none;
}
.headpostsummary
{
	font: bold 13px arial ;
	color: #000000;
	text-decoration: none;
}
/*.posttitle
{
	font:bold 11px verdana;
	color:#6F95AF;
	text-decoration:uderline;
}
.posttitle a:hover
{
	font:bold 11px verdana;
	color:#6F95AF;
	text-decoration:none;
}
.posttitle a:visited
{
	font:bold 11px verdana;
	color:#6F95AF;
	text-decoration:uderline;
}
.posttitle a:link
{
	font:bold 11px verdana;
	color:#6F95AF;
	text-decoration:uderline;
}
*/
.posttitle
{
	font:bold 16px Arial;
	color:#000000;
	text-decoration:none;
	border-bottom:dotted 1px #000000;
}
.posttitle a:link
{
	font:bold 16px Arial;
	color:#000000;
	text-decoration:none;
	border-bottom:dotted 1px #666666;
}
.posttitle a:visited
{
	font:bold 16px Arial;
	color:#000000;
	text-decoration:none;
	border-bottom:dotted 1px #000000;
}
.posttitle a:hover
{
	font:bold 16px Arial;
	color:#000000;
	text-decoration:none;
	border-bottom:dotted 0px #000000;
}
.postby
{
	font:normal 11px verdana;
	color:#6F95AF;
	text-decoration:uderline;
}
.postby a:hover
{
	font:normal 11px verdana;
	color:#6F95AF;
	text-decoration:none;
}
.postby a:visited
{
	font:normal 11px verdana;
	color:#6F95AF;
	text-decoration:uderline;
}
.postby a:link
{
	font:normal 11px verdana;
	color:#6F95AF;
	text-decoration:uderline;
}
.postcomment
{
	font: normal 14px arial ;
	color: #000000;
	text-decoration: none;
	line-height:1.5;
}
.postcomment a:link
{
	font: normal 14px arial ;
	color: #000000;
	text-decoration: Underline;
	line-height:1.5;
}
.postcomment a:visited
{
	font: normal 14px arial ;
	color: #000000;
	text-decoration: none;
	line-height:1.5;
}
.postcomment a:hover
{
	font: normal 14px arial ;
	color: #000000;
	text-decoration: none;
	line-height:1.5;
}
.contentbold
{
	font: bold 13px arial ;
	color: #676767;
	text-decoration: none;
}
.contentselected
{
	font: bold 11px arial ;
	color: #676767;
	text-decoration: none;
}
.commentlink
{
	font: normal 13px arial ;
	color: #6B6B6B;             /* #ff6c00 */
	text-decoration: none;
}
.commentlink a:link
{
	font: normal 13px arial ;
	color: #6B6B6B;             /* #ff6c00 */
	text-decoration: underline;
}
.commentlink a:visited
{
	font: normal 13px arial ;
	color: #6B6B6B;             /* #ff6c00 */
	text-decoration: underline;
}
.commentlink a:hover
{
	font: normal 13px arial ;
	color: #6B6B6B;             /* #ff6c00 */
	text-decoration: none;
}

/*Newly added*/
.heading
{
	font:bold 13pt "Times New Roman", arial,verdana;
	color:#FF9502;
	text-decoration:none;
}
.headlink
{
	font:bold 12px verdana,arial,"Times New Roman";
	color:#FF9502;
	text-decoration:none;	
}
.headlink a:active
{
	font:bold 12px verdana,arial,"Times New Roman";
	color:#FF9502;
	text-decoration:none;	
}
.headlink a:active
{
	font:bold 12px verdana,arial,"Times New Roman";
	color:#FF9502;
	text-decoration:none;	
}
.headlink a:hover
{
	font:bold 12px verdana,arial,"Times New Roman";
	color:#FF9502;
	text-decoration:underline;	
}
.topborder
{
	border-top:solid 2px #FDEDD9;
}
.paddingAll
{
	padding:0 10 10 10;
}